测试: BMPA摘要卡链接不应继承fail_only上下文

This commit is contained in:
萝卜
2026-03-18 12:55:38 +08:00
parent b0e31eb7f5
commit 5df16e6634

View File

@@ -61,11 +61,16 @@ class AdminPlatformOrderBmpaFailedSummaryCardTest extends TestCase
],
]);
$res = $this->get('/admin/platform-orders');
// 模拟从同步失败上下文进入fail_only=1摘要卡链接不应残留 fail_only
$res = $this->get('/admin/platform-orders?fail_only=1');
$res->assertOk();
$res->assertSee('BMPA 成功 / 失败');
$res->assertSee('/admin/platform-orders?bmpa_failed_only=1', false);
$res->assertSee('/admin/platform-orders?bmpa_success_only=1', false);
// 不应出现携带 fail_only=1 的 BMPA 摘要卡链接(避免口径冲突/空结果)
$res->assertDontSee('/admin/platform-orders?fail_only=1&bmpa_failed_only=1', false);
$res->assertDontSee('/admin/platform-orders?fail_only=1&bmpa_success_only=1', false);
}
}